背景
-
Background: Baculoviral IAP Repeat-Containing Protein 5 (BIRC5) belongs to the IAP family. BIRC5 exists as a homodimer in the apo state and as a monomer in the CPC-bound state. BIRC5 contains one BIR repeat and is expressed only in fetal kidney and liver, and to lesser extent, lung and brain. BIRC5 functions as a multitasking protein that has dual roles in promoting cell proliferation and preventing apoptosis. BIRC5 is also a component of a chromosome passage protein complex (CPC), which is essential for chromosome alignment and segregation during mitosis and cytokinesis. BIRC5 acts as an important regulator of the localization of this complex.
